通过机构ID查询机构名称
This commit is contained in:
@@ -12,4 +12,14 @@ import com.openhis.administration.domain.Organization;
|
|||||||
*/
|
*/
|
||||||
public interface IOrganizationService extends IService<Organization> {
|
public interface IOrganizationService extends IService<Organization> {
|
||||||
Page<Organization> getOrganizationPage(Integer classEnum,Integer activeFlag, Integer pageNo, Integer pageSize);
|
Page<Organization> getOrganizationPage(Integer classEnum,Integer activeFlag, Integer pageNo, Integer pageSize);
|
||||||
|
|
||||||
|
|
||||||
|
/**
|
||||||
|
* 通过机构ID查询机构名称
|
||||||
|
*
|
||||||
|
* @param code 机构ID
|
||||||
|
* @return 机构名称
|
||||||
|
*/
|
||||||
|
Organization getByCode(String code);
|
||||||
|
|
||||||
}
|
}
|
||||||
@@ -1,5 +1,6 @@
|
|||||||
package com.openhis.administration.service.impl;
|
package com.openhis.administration.service.impl;
|
||||||
|
|
||||||
|
import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
|
||||||
import org.springframework.beans.factory.annotation.Autowired;
|
import org.springframework.beans.factory.annotation.Autowired;
|
||||||
import org.springframework.stereotype.Service;
|
import org.springframework.stereotype.Service;
|
||||||
|
|
||||||
@@ -50,4 +51,18 @@ public class OrganizationServiceImpl extends ServiceImpl<OrganizationMapper, Org
|
|||||||
return organizationPage;
|
return organizationPage;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
/**
|
||||||
|
* 通过机构ID查询机构名称
|
||||||
|
*
|
||||||
|
* @param code 机构ID
|
||||||
|
* @return 机构名称
|
||||||
|
*/
|
||||||
|
@Override
|
||||||
|
public Organization getByCode(String code) {
|
||||||
|
QueryWrapper<Organization> queryWrapper = new QueryWrapper<>();
|
||||||
|
//设置查询条件为机构Id code
|
||||||
|
queryWrapper.eq("code", code);
|
||||||
|
return organizationMapper.selectOne(queryWrapper);
|
||||||
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
Reference in New Issue
Block a user